Ask which fuel is cheapest per kilometre in India and the answer is not petrol, not diesel and, for most households, not electricity. It is compressed natural gas, pumped at a rate that has stayed below liquid fuels for as long as the network has existed. Ask why more cars do not run on it and the answer is about inconvenience rather than money.
What the kit actually is
A CNG car is a petrol car with a second fuel system bolted alongside it, and the engine itself is almost unchanged. What matters is a high-pressure cylinder in the boot, filled to many times tyre pressure; shut-off valves and solenoids between it and the engine; a regulator that drops the pressure to something an inlet manifold can use; and injectors that meter the gas into the air charge.
The distinction that decides whether the car is any good is how the gas gets metered. On a static mixer, the oldest arrangement, gas is drawn through a venturi and the mixture is set mechanically, which is why those cars lose power and run badly when the tuning drifts. On a sequential kit, the engine’s own computer meters gas through dedicated injectors once the engine is warm, and the driveability penalty shrinks to something you notice only as the cylinder runs down. Factory kits are sequential; CNG’s bad reputation in India was earned by aftermarket static mixers fitted in workshops that had other work to do.
The car starts on petrol, switches over once the engine is warm, and falls back to petrol when the gas runs out, usually so subtly that new owners miss it. There is a switch on the dash, and there is a boot you no longer entirely have.
The economics, honestly
The saving is real and it is proportional to distance. A car covering a couple of thousand kilometres a year saves a sum that will never justify anything. A car doing thirty or forty thousand — a taxi, a sales run, one car and two commuters — moves into a bracket where the kit pays for itself and then keeps paying.
What eats into that number is not the pump rate but everything around it:
- The purchase premium. A factory CNG variant costs more than the petrol car it is built on, and more than the mid-trim you would actually have bought.
- The boot. The cylinder lives in the luggage space, and it is the most common reason a household returns a CNG car within a year: on a hatchback that is most of the practical boot, on a sedan a shallow shelf.
- Resale. A used CNG car is a narrower market than a used petrol one, and buyers who cannot verify a cylinder’s certification history price that hesitation into the offer.
- Refuelling geography. CNG pays only where the network is dense enough that you never plan around it. In some metros it is a normal part of a route; elsewhere the nearest pump is a detour and the queue at it is an appointment.
- The efficiency give-back. Gas carries less energy per unit volume than petrol, so the car returns fewer kilometres per unit even before the extra weight. The saving comes from the price gap, not from the thermodynamics.
CNG does not make your car cheaper to buy or nicer to drive. It makes it cheaper to run, and only if you run it enough.
What it feels like to drive
A well-installed sequential kit is close to invisible below about 3,000 rpm, which is where Indian driving mostly happens. Above that, and particularly with the air conditioning on and four aboard, the difference appears: gas engines make slightly less torque, and a car that was already working at 4,000 rpm to pass a bus now needs a gear. An automatic hides most of it behind the converter.
The other change is in character rather than numbers. The engine runs more quietly and smells of nothing at a signal, and there is always a second tank underneath the first: when the gas gives out mid-journey the car simply continues on petrol. Range is the quiet limitation. A cylinder holds a modest amount of energy, so the gas-only distance between fills is well short of the petrol tank’s, and a trip has to be planned around the two added together.
The safety question, properly
The cylinder is engineered to a pressure well above working pressure, tested individually and stamped with a certification that expires. A shut-off solenoid closes when the engine is off, a crash-activated cut-off isolates the supply on impact, and gas is lighter than air, so a leak disperses upward rather than pooling the way petrol does — which is why an installation that blocks a ventilation path is the wrong way to do this job.
The failure mode in India is not engineering. It is a kit fitted outside the manufacturer’s network, into a car whose warranty then discovers a dispute, and a re-certification that quietly lapsed three years ago. Buy a factory car, keep the paperwork, and the argument about CNG safety is an argument about somebody else’s installation.
What to check before you commit
Our catalogue lists no factory CNG variants among the cars we publish figures for, which is itself informative: CNG makes most sense in the volume hatchback and sedan bracket, and Maruti offers gas options across its line-up in the wider market. So this is a check list rather than a pick, to apply to whichever showroom quote you are holding.
Ask which of the three systems it is — factory kit, dealer-fitted, or a recommended workshop. The warranty and servicing answers follow automatically.
Ask what remains of the boot. Then look, physically, at the cylinder in the car you are being quoted.
Ask how many pumps are on your two regular routes, not how many are in your city. The one you pass daily is the only one that will get used.
Ask what the kit does to the serviced price — the re-certification cycle, the valve-clearance interval, and whether the local network stocks the gas-specific parts at all.
Ask the annual-distance question out loud. Below roughly the middle of the private-car range in India, a CNG car is an exercise in patience for a saving that pays for one holiday every few years. Above it, and inside a city with a dense pump network, it is the cheapest way to run a combustion engine that anyone has found without a charging point.
Frequently asked questions
Is a CNG car cheaper to run than a petrol one?
Per kilometre, almost always, in the cities where gas is cheap and available. Over the whole ownership period the saving has to survive a higher purchase price, a lost portion of the boot, a resale discount and the servicing the cylinder demands, which is why the answer depends on your annual distance rather than on the pump rate.
Is CNG safe in a crash?
A factory-fitted kit with a correctly certified cylinder, a shut-off solenoid and a crash-cut arrangement is a safety-certified part of the vehicle, tested as such at type approval. An aftermarket installation in an unventilated boot space is a different object entirely, and the difference is the installer, not the gas.
Does a CNG car need more servicing?
Slightly. The valve seats and the ignition components live a harder life on gas, the periodic cylinder re-certification is a legal requirement with a fixed cycle, and the plumbing needs checking for leaks. None of it is expensive; all of it is easy to postpone and unwise to.
